repo.or.cz
/
musl.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
dns query core: detect udp truncation at recv time
2022-10-19
R
i
ch Fe
l
ker
dns query core: detect udp trun
c
ation a
t
recv ti
m
e
commit
|
commitdiff
|
tree
2022-10-19
Ric
h
Felker
getaddrinfo dns lookup: use larger ans
w
e
r buffer to
.
.
.
commit
|
commitdiff
|
tree
2022-09-22
Ric
h
Fel
k
er
a
r
pa/nameser
.
h: update
R
R types list
commit
|
commitdiff
|
tree
2022-09-22
Rich Felker
dns: implement
t
c
p fall
b
ack in __re
s
_msend query core
commit
|
commitdiff
|
tree
2022-09-22
R
i
ch F
e
lker
res_se
n
d: use a t
e
mp buffer if ca
l
ler's buffer is under
.
.
.
commit
|
commitdiff
|
tree
2022-09-21
Rich Felker
adapt re
s
_msend DNS query core for
w
orking
w
i
th multiple
.
.
.
commit
|
commitdiff
|
tree
2022-09-20
Rich
Felker
getaddrinfo: add
E
AI_NODATA error code to dist
i
nguish
.
.
.
commit
|
commitdiff
|
tree
2022-09-19
Rich
F
e
l
ker
f
i
x er
r
or cases in gethostbyaddr_r
commit
|
commitdiff
|
tree
2022-09-19
Rich Fel
k
er
re
m
ove
im
p
ossible error cas
e
from get
h
o
s
t
byname
2
_
r
commit
|
commitdiff
|
tree
2022-09-19
Ric
h
Felker
fix return value
o
f ge
t
hostnbyname
[
2]_r on re
s
ult not
.
.
.
commit
|
commitdiff
|
tree
2022-09-19
Ri
c
h Felke
r
dns:
t
re
a
t names rejected by res_
m
k
q
uery as nonexistent
.
.
.
commit
|
commitdiff
|
tree
2022-09-19
R
ic
h
Felker
re
s
_
m
kquery: error out on consecutive final dots in
.
.
.
commit
|
commitdiff
|
tree
2022-09-19
Rich Felker
re-enable vdso clock
_
gettime
on arm
(32-bit) with workaroun
d
commit
|
commitdiff
|
tree
2022-09-12
Rich Felker
p
roces
s
DT_RELR relocations in l
d
so-startup/static-pie
commit
|
commitdiff
|
tree
2022-09-07
Rich Felker
fix fwprintf m
i
ssing output t
o
open_wme
m
s
t
ream FILEs
commit
|
commitdiff
|
tree
2022-08-26
Rich Felk
e
r
dns:
fail i
f
ipv
6
is disabled and resolv
.
conf has
o
n
ly
.
.
.
commit
|
commitdiff
|
tree
2022-08-26
Rich Fe
l
ker
u
s
e kernel-p
r
ovided
AT_MINSIGSTKS
Z
for s
y
sconf(_SC_
.
.
.
commit
|
commitdiff
|
tree
2022-08-26
Rich
Felker
add sysconf keys/values for signal st
a
ck si
z
e
commit
|
commitdiff
|
tree
2022-08-25
Rich Felker
fix f
a
llback wh
e
n ipv6 is dis
a
bled bu
t
re
s
o
l
v
.
con
f
.
.
.
commit
|
commitdiff
|
tree
2022-08-20
Rich Felker
use
a
l
t signal
stack when present for i
m
plementation
.
.
.
commit
|
commitdiff
|
tree
2022-08-17
Ri
c
h Felker
f
reo
p
en:
res
e
t s
t
ream
orientation (
b
yte/wide) and
en
c
oding
.
.
.
commit
|
commitdiff
|
tree
2022-08-02
Rich Felker
ld
s
o: process
R
ELR only for non-FDPIC arc
h
s
commit
|
commitdiff
|
tree
2022-08-01
Rich
F
elker
fix
m
ishandli
n
g of errno
in getaddrinfo AI_
A
D
D
RCONF
I
G
.
.
.
commit
|
commitdiff
|
tree
2022-07-19
Rich Felker
early stage lds
o
: rem
o
ve s
y
mbolic referen
c
es via
e
rror
.
.
.
commit
|
commitdiff
|
tree
2022-06-23
Rich Felker
a
void
l
imited space of random tem
p
f
i
le name
s
if
clock
.
.
.
commit
|
commitdiff
|
tree
2022-06-03
R
i
ch Fe
l
ker
remove random filenam
e
obfu
s
c
ation t
h
at leaks ASL
R
.
.
.
commit
|
commitdiff
|
tree
2022-06-03
Rich
Fel
k
er
ensure distinct q
u
ery id for paralle
l
A a
n
d
AAAA queries
.
.
.
commit
|
commitdiff
|
tree
2022-05-15
Ric
h
Felker
mnt
e
n
t:
f
i
x po
t
ential
mishandlin
g
of extremely
long
.
.
.
commit
|
commitdiff
|
tree
2022-05-06
Rich F
e
lker
fix
co
n
st
r
aint viol
a
ti
o
n
i
n qs
o
rt wrap
p
er
a
r
o
und qsort
_
r
commit
|
commitdiff
|
tree
2022-05-04
Rich Felker
use __fs
t
at instead
of
_
_fst
a
tat with AT_EM
P
TY_
P
ATH
.
.
.
commit
|
commitdiff
|
tree
2022-05-04
Rich Felker
provide an int
e
r
nal n
a
mes
p
ace-safe __
f
st
a
t
commit
|
commitdiff
|
tree
2022-05-02
R
ich Felk
e
r
only use fst
a
tat a
n
d others le
g
a
c
y stat s
y
scall
s
if
.
.
.
commit
|
commitdiff
|
tree
2022-05-02
Rich Felker
drop direc
t
use of stat sy
s
calls in
inte
r
nal __map_
f
il
e
commit
|
commitdiff
|
tree
2022-05-02
Rich Fel
k
e
r
prov
i
de an
internal namespace-
s
afe __fstatat
commit
|
commitdiff
|
tree
2022-05-02
Rich Felker
drop
d
ire
c
t
u
s
e of stat
s
y
scalls in
fch
m
odat
commit
|
commitdiff
|
tree
2022-05-02
R
i
ch Felke
r
drop use of stat ope
r
ation
in temp
o
rary fi
l
e name generation
commit
|
commitdiff
|
tree
2022-04-20
Rich Felker
add missing POSIX con
f
str
k
eys for pthread CFLAGS/LDFLAG
S
commit
|
commitdiff
|
tree
2022-04-07
Rich Fel
k
e
r
r
elease 1
.
2
.
3
commit
|
commitdiff
|
tree
2022-03-08
R
ich Felk
e
r
fi
x
__WORDSIZE o
n
x32 sy
s
/user
.
h
commit
|
commitdiff
|
tree
2022-02-21
Rich Felker
f
ix sp
u
r
ious failures by fgetws when
b
uffer ends with
.
.
.
commit
|
commitdiff
|
tree
2022-02-09
Ri
c
h
Felker
fi
x
out-of-bou
n
d r
e
ad
p
rocessing time zone data with
.
.
.
commit
|
commitdiff
|
tree
2022-01-18
Rich F
e
lker
fix
p
o
tentially wrong-s
i
gn zero in cp
r
oj functions
.
.
.
commit
|
commitdiff
|
tree
2022-01-09
Rich Felker
make fseek detect and
produce an er
r
or
fo
r
in
v
ali
d
.
.
.
commit
|
commitdiff
|
tree
2021-12-28
Rich F
e
lk
e
r
fix wcwidth
o
f ha
n
g
u
l
c
ombining (v
o
wel/fina
l
) let
t
e
rs
commit
|
commitdiff
|
tree
2021-12-09
Rich Fe
l
ke
r
fix
mismatched si
g
na
t
ure
s
for strtod_l
fa
m
ily
commit
|
commitdiff
|
tree
2021-11-29
Ri
c
h
F
elker
fix hw
c
ap access in power
p
c
-
sf setjmp/longjmp
commit
|
commitdiff
|
tree
2021-10-19
Rich
F
el
k
er
fix
struct layout mismatch in sound ioctl
time32 fallb
a
ck
.
.
.
commit
|
commitdiff
|
tree
2021-09-23
R
ich Felker
add
S
PE
FPU support to po
w
erpc-sf
commit
|
commitdiff
|
tree
2021-09-12
R
i
ch
F
e
l
k
e
r
fix undefined behavior in getdelim via
n
u
l
l
p
ointer
.
.
.
commit
|
commitdiff
|
tree
2021-08-12
Rich Felker
fix exc
e
ssi
v
ely slow TL
S
performa
n
ce on some mips
models
commit
|
commitdiff
|
tree
2021-07-30
Rich Felker
fix libc-internal signal b
l
o
c
king on mips archs
commit
|
commitdiff
|
tree
2021-07-07
R
i
ch Felker
fix
b
roken struct shmi
d
_d
s
on powerp
c
(
32-b
i
t)
commit
|
commitdiff
|
tree
2021-06-23
Rich F
e
l
k
er
fix T
Z
parsing l
o
gic for identifying POSIX-form strings
commit
|
commitdiff
|
tree
2021-04-20
Ric
h
Felker
fix popen
n
o
t
to leak pipes from o
n
e child to another
commit
|
commitdiff
|
tree
2021-04-20
R
ich
F
elker
r
emov
e
spur
i
o
u
s lock in po
p
en
commit
|
commitdiff
|
tree
2021-04-16
Rich Fe
l
ker
fix r
e
gression
i
n dl_iterate_phdr reporting
of modules
.
.
.
commit
|
commitdiff
|
tree
2021-04-04
Rich Felker
make
epoll_[p]wait a
cancella
t
ion p
o
int
commit
|
commitdiff
|
tree
2021-03-26
R
i
ch Fel
k
er
fix dl_iterate_phdr
d
lpi_tls_data reporting to match
.
.
.
commit
|
commitdiff
|
tree
2021-03-15
Rich Felke
r
remove no
-
longe
r
-nee
d
ed s
p
e
cial
c
a
se hand
l
ing in pop
e
n
commit
|
commitdiff
|
tree
2021-03-15
R
ich
F
elker
use intern
a
l mal
l
oc
for
p
osix
_
spawn fi
l
e actions ob
j
ects
commit
|
commitdiff
|
tree
2021-03-05
R
i
ch
Felker
don't f
a
il to map
l
ibr
a
ry/ex
e
cu
t
able w
i
th zero-length
.
.
.
commit
|
commitdiff
|
tree
2021-02-22
R
ich Fe
l
k
e
r
gua
r
d aga
i
n
s
t compilers
f
ailing
t
o handle se
t
j
mp specia
l
ly
.
.
.
commit
|
commitdiff
|
tree
2021-02-13
Rich Fel
k
er
fix
e
rror
r
etur
n
value for cuserid
commit
|
commitdiff
|
tree
2021-02-13
Rich
F
e
l
ker
f
i
x misus
e
of getpwui
d
_r
in cuserid
commit
|
commitdiff
|
tree
2021-02-13
Rich
Felker
cuserid: don't
r
e
turn truncate
d
res
u
lts
commit
|
commitdiff
|
tree
2021-01-30
Rich Fel
k
er
o
ldmallo
c
: prese
r
ve err
n
o a
c
ross
free
commit
|
commitdiff
|
tree
2021-01-30
Rich Fe
l
ke
r
fix build regres
s
ion in oldmalloc
commit
|
commitdiff
|
tree
2021-01-30
Rich
F
e
l
k
er
preserve errno across fre
e
commit
|
commitdiff
|
tree
2021-01-30
R
ich Felker
fix
inconsis
t
ent sig
n
ature of __l
i
bc
_
start_main
commit
|
commitdiff
|
tree
2021-01-30
Ri
c
h F
e
lker
fail posix_s
p
a
w
n file_actions o
p
era
t
ions with
n
egative fds
commit
|
commitdiff
|
tree
2021-01-15
R
i
ch Felker
release 1
.
2
.
2
commit
|
commitdiff
|
tree
2020-12-15
R
ich Felker
fix VIDI
O
C_DQEVENT
(v4l2) ioctl fal
l
back fo
r
pre-5
.
.
.
commit
|
commitdiff
|
tree
2020-12-09
Rich Felker
use libc-internal malloc fo
r
new
l
ocale/
f
reelocale
commit
|
commitdiff
|
tree
2020-12-09
Rich F
e
lker
drop u
s
e of p
t
hread_
o
nce in
newloca
l
e
commit
|
commitdiff
|
tree
2020-12-09
Ri
c
h Felker
l
ift locale lock out of internal
_
_g
e
t_
l
ocale
commit
|
commitdiff
|
tree
2020-12-09
Ric
h
F
elker
f
i
x misleading co
m
ment in s
t
rstr
commit
|
commitdiff
|
tree
2020-12-08
Rich Felker
drop use of pthr
e
ad_once
for aio thread stack size
.
.
.
commit
|
commitdiff
|
tree
2020-12-07
Rich Felker
fix omissi
o
n of non-stub pthread_mutexattr_getpr
o
tocol
commit
|
commitdiff
|
tree
2020-12-04
Ric
h
Fel
k
er
f
i
x
fa
i
lur
e
t
o preserve
r6 in s3
9
0x
asm; per ABI it
.
.
.
commit
|
commitdiff
|
tree
2020-11-30
Rich F
e
lker
i
m
plement realpath
d
i
rectly in
s
t
e
ad of using procfs
.
.
.
commit
|
commitdiff
|
tree
2020-11-24
Ric
h
Felk
e
r
work ar
o
und li
n
ux bu
g
in readlink syscal
l
w
ith
z
e
r
o
.
.
.
commit
|
commitdiff
|
tree
2020-11-22
Ri
c
h
F
elker
parse
v3 or future-unkno
w
n zon
e
info file v
e
rsio
n
s
a
s v2+
commit
|
commitdiff
|
tree
2020-11-22
Rich Fel
k
er
explicitly prefer 64-b
i
t/v2
z
oneinfo tables
commit
|
commitdiff
|
tree
2020-11-20
Rich Felker
fix regression in p
t
h
read_e
x
it
commit
|
commitdiff
|
tree
2020-11-19
Rich Fel
k
er
rewri
t
e
wcsnrtom
b
s t
o
f
i
x buffer ove
r
flow and oth
e
r
.
.
.
commit
|
commitdiff
|
tree
2020-11-19
R
i
ch Felker
protect dest
r
uction of
process-s
h
a
red mute
x
es
a
gainst
.
.
.
commit
|
commitdiff
|
tree
2020-11-19
Ri
c
h
F
e
l
ker
pthre
a
d_exit: do
n
'
t
__vm_wait un
d
er thread list lock
commit
|
commitdiff
|
tree
2020-11-11
Ric
h
F
elk
e
r
lift ch
i
ld
r
estrictions after
m
u
lti-
t
hreaded fo
r
k
commit
|
commitdiff
|
tree
2020-11-11
Rich Felk
e
r
convert m
a
llo
c
us
e
under li
b
c-internal locks
t
o
use
.
.
.
commit
|
commitdiff
|
tree
2020-11-11
R
ich Felker
give
l
i
bc
acc
e
ss to its own mallo
c
eve
n
if pub
l
ic mall
o
c
.
.
.
commit
|
commitdiff
|
tree
2020-11-11
Rich Fe
l
k
e
r
drop use o
f
getdelim/stdio in dyn
a
mic linker
commit
|
commitdiff
|
tree
2020-11-11
R
i
ch Felker
d
ler
r
or: don
'
t gra
t
uit
o
usly hold
free
b
uf_
q
u
e
ue
l
oc
k
.
.
.
commit
|
commitdiff
|
tree
2020-11-11
Rich Felker
f
ix v
e
c
t
o
r typ
e
s
in
aarch64 re
g
ister f
i
le struc
t
ures
commit
|
commitdiff
|
tree
2020-10-30
R
ich Felker
fix erroneous pthread_cond_wait mutex w
a
i
t
er c
o
unt
.
.
.
commit
|
commitdiff
|
tree
2020-10-30
Rich Felk
e
r
fi
x
missi
n
g
-
wak
e
re
g
ression
in pthread
_
cond_wai
t
commit
|
commitdiff
|
tree
2020-10-28
Rich Fe
l
k
er
f
ix sem_close
u
n
mapping of still
-
referenced semaphore
commit
|
commitdiff
|
tree
2020-10-27
Ri
c
h Fe
l
ker
refactor setxid re
t
urn
path to use
__sysc
a
ll_ret
commit
|
commitdiff
|
tree
2020-10-27
R
ich Felker
f
i
x setgroups be
h
avior in m
u
l
t
ith
r
eaded
process
commit
|
commitdiff
|
tree
2020-10-27
Ri
c
h Felker
avo
i
d
_
_sy
n
c
ca
l
l fo
r
setrlimit on
k
e
rnels with prlimi
t
.
.
.
commit
|
commitdiff
|
tree
2020-10-26
Rich Fe
l
ker
fix r
e
intr
o
duction of
e
rrno cl
o
bb
e
ring by a
t
f
ork han
d
lers
commit
|
commitdiff
|
tree
next